If you're focused on the future, style is looking at new structure technologies. Admission right into an undergraduate style program is typically a two-step process.


This could be a 5 year B.arch undergraduate program or a mix of a bachelor's degree or BS in style (or another significant) followed by an M.arch academic degree. Architecture is an extremely regulated career, beginning with university programs. The buildings designed by signed up engineers need to be risk-free. The college programs, useful experience, and licensure tests make sure engineers have the training important to shield the wellness, safety, and welfare of individuals who will certainly occupy their buildings.


In addition to institutional needs, trainees might take architectural history, landscape, and metropolitan layout. They additionally get sensible experience learning to use shop tools and via studio courses that obtain progressively complex yearly. Some programs likewise call for co-ops where a student works in a style firm for a term.

Graduates from a NAAB recognized architecture program should finish a specialist internship of numerous years functioning under the supervision of a registered engineer. Once they have actually amassed enough experience, they can rest for the Architectural Registration Examination (ARE), a collection of 6 examinations, and come to be licensed.


The majority of states call for continuous proceeding education as component of the yearly permit renewal procedure. Design is a challenging job to seek. Given the public trust that the structures where we live, function, and play will not fall down while we're inside them, that strenuous education, training, and screening, is important. In the USA, there are only 121,997 licensed architects.
